Ryan Murphy’s latest for Netflix is a bona fide hit, with “Ratched” catapulting to the top of the streaming service’s offerings to become its most-watched series debut of 2020.
Peter White Television EditorNetflix has revealed that 48M people have checked in to Lucia State Hospital to make Sarah Paulson-fronted drama Ratched the streamer’s best new original launch of the year.The SVOD service revealed the numbers on social media saying that the Ryan Murphy-exec produced drama hit the 48M mark over its first 28 days to make it the “biggest original season one of the year”.It is the latest example of Netflix sharing viewing data in success.

The producer’s first Netflix series, Ratched, dropped on the streaming giant on Friday, September 18, introducing the world to an entirely new Nurse Ratched — a character featured in the 1975 drama One Flew Over the Cuckoo’s Nest.The thrilling drama is dark, twisted and at times, very funny, following the life of Sarah Paulson‘s Ratched, a nurse who cons her way into on a job at a mental hospital.

While Ratched delves into how Nurse Ratched — Mildred, as we learn at the outset of these eight episodes — becomes the villain that she is, the bulk of Season 1 plops us right into the action as she begins a campaign of torment and terror for reasons that soon become clear.
Ryan Murphy's Ratched has been billed as the story of how Nurse Ratched from One Flew Over the Cuckoo's Nest becomes the stiff, forcefulauthoritarian of a psychiatric hospital we see in the film, but that description doesn't exactly jibe with the eight episodes sent to critics.
